As reported in an earlier exclusive, SaddoBoxing had the privilege of receiving a personal phone call from "The Mechanic" Chris Smith last night (May 24),
about a matter that has been confirmed today. Smith will be the next opponent for Sharmba "Little Big Man" Mitchell on the Tyson-McBride fight card. The fight will be held in Washington D.C., the hometown of Sharmba Mitchell. Chris states, "I'm excited and I will take full advantage of this situation." SaddoBoxing has had the privilege of speaking with Chris since his first and only loss to David Estrada, and, through the weeks of his intense training for this June fight date.
